PRINCIPLE: A person is liable for any damage which is the direct consequence of his/her unlawful act, as long as the consequence could have been foreseen by a reasonable person.
FACTUAL SITUATION: During a scuffle, B knocked A unconscious and then placed A at the foot of a hill at night. when the temperature was around one degree centigrade. A suffered from hypothermia and had to be hospitalised for a week. A sues B.
